Q: Is 5,178,136 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 5,178,136 is a composite number.

Why is 5,178,136 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 5,178,136 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 41 82 164 328 15,787 31,574 63,148 126,296 647,267 1,294,534 2,589,068 and 5,178,136, with no remainder.

Since 5,178,136 cannot be divided by just 1 and 5,178,136, it is a composite number.
